**CI note: TideScope widget rendering failures on nightly**

The TideScope tide-table widget fails its snapshot tests whenever the nightly build crosses a DST boundary in the Fennwick test fixtures. Pin the fixture timezone to UTC before comparing rendered charts, and regenerate baselines only after confirming the harbor dataset loaded. Flag any remaining mismatches at the sync. The failing build's trace token is below.

pipeline stamp: htk9_ce63042d9

Prepared for the board of Quillhaven Systems.

We propose moving all Meridix subscriptions from monthly to annual billing. Modeling shows a 7-point improvement in cash position and reduced churn of roughly 3%. Risks: short-term friction for smaller accounts and a projected 5% opt-out rate. Mitigation includes a two-month discount window and grandfathering legacy plans through year-end. Sales and support are staffed for the transition. Finance has validated all assumptions. The confidential strategic context for this change follows.

board note of fahif-yahog: Gross margin on Wenath came in at 10 percent against a plan of 5 percent. Only 3 of the 100 pilot accounts renewed Wenath, so a churn review is set for July 15.

Finance Review Summary — Rewards Refresh

Quick one for branch managers: the Compass Club overhaul is tracking slightly over budget, mostly down to the points-conversion tooling. Redemption costs should drop about 11% once the new tiers land, so the payback case still holds. Hold off on local promos until the central launch. The strategic reasoning from the exec team is captured just below.

internal memo for hahaf-kahof: Only 39 of the 428 pilot accounts renewed Sorion, so a churn review is set for April 12. Praokix Freight is in early talks to buy Queniusox Group for about $145.8 million.